Punteggio 16.5/20 · Da bere 1965-1990, Jancis Robinson MW, Nov 2007

Great colour. This tasted very rich, toasty and sweetish at first but it oxidised in the glass and became distinctly acidic. Shame as some of the flavour elements of it opened out in the glass. A disappointing bottle. (JR)

Punteggio 98/100 · Da bere 2000-2020, Robert Parker, Jun 2000

On each of the previous occasions I have had this wine it has flirted with perfection. This bottle was again a riveting, opulently-textured drinking experience. Its spectacularly perfumed bouquet consists of truffles, black tea, soy, minerals, and copious sweet prune, coffee-infused, black currant fruit. Sweet on the attack, with a rare opulence, a voluptuous texture, full body, terrific freshness, and a chewy, fleshy, succulent finish, this has always been great stuff. This bottle was no exception. It has been fully mature for 25-30 years, but well-stored or larger format bottlings will last another two decades.

Uno dei cinque "Primi Cru" di Bordeaux, classificato nel 1855, Ch. Latour è tra i più famosi di Pauillac e del mondo. La tenuta è rinomata per i suoi vini longevi, potenti e strutturati.
